Stephens County was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their sixth straight loss dating back to last season. They came up short against the Morgan County Bulldogs, falling 58-37.
Leading Morgan County to victory were Cydney Burke and Jaden Young. Burke went 8 for 15 en route to 21 points plus five rebounds and five steals, while Young went 5 for 10 en route to 13 points plus six rebounds and four steals. With that strong performance, Young is now averaging an impressive 2.1 steals per game. The team also got some help courtesy of Miracle Ward, who earned five points.
Stephens County's defeat dropped their record down to 0-4. As for Morgan County, they moved to 3-4 with that victory, which also ended their four-game losing streak.
